#912E25 Hex Color Code

#912E25

The Hexadecimal Color #912E25 is a contrast shade of Brown. #912E25 RGB value is rgb(145, 46, 37). RGB Color Model of #912E25 consists of 56% red, 18% green and 14% blue. HSL color Mode of #912E25 has 5°(degrees) Hue, 59% Saturation and 36% Lightness. #912E25 color has an wavelength of 616.85185n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#912E25 is #993333.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#912E25 is #932. The Closest Color to #912E25 is #A52A2A. Official Name of #912E25 Hex Code is Burnt Umber.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#912E25 is 0 Cyan 68 Magenta 74 Yellow 43 Black and #912E25 CMY is 0, 68, 74.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#912E25 is hsl(5,59,36,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(5, 74, 57).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#912E25 is 12.99, 8.11, 2.63.
Hex8 Value of #912E25 is #912E25FF. Decimal Value of #912E25 is 9514533 and Octal Value of #912E25 is 44227045. Binary Value of #912E25 is 10010001, 101110, 100101 and Android of #912E25 is 4287704613 / 0xff912e25.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#912E25 is 0.547, 0.342, 0.342 and YIQ Color Space of #912E25 is 74.575, 61.8858, 18.1377.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#912E25 is 12.58, 4.64, 2.74.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#912E25 is 34.21, 41.12, 28.76.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#912E25 is 34.21, 74.15, 19.46.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#912E25 is 34.21, 50.18, 34.97. Hunter Lab variable of #912E25 is 28.48, 31.58, 14.46.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#912E25

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
